The Rise of Mobile-First Indexing

Mobile usage has skyrocketed, making mobile-first indexing a necessity. Google introduced this approach in 2018, but by 2026, it’s the primary means of ranking websites. This shift emphasizes the importance of having a mobile-friendly website with fast load times and easy navigation.

To ensure your website is mobile-friendly, prioritize responsive design, optimize images for quick loading, and make sure your content is easily readable on smaller screens. Remember that a seamless mobile experience can significantly impact your SEO rankings and user engagement.

Section 4: The Impact of Voice Search on SEO

With the growing popularity of smart speakers like Amazon Echo and Google Home, voice search has become an essential aspect of digital publishing. In 2026, optimizing content for voice search is no longer optional but a necessity.

To excel in this area, publishers should focus on long-tail keywords, natural language phrases, and structured data to ensure their content ranks high in voice search results. For instance, instead of targeting the keyword “best restaurants,” publishers could aim for longer phrases like “restaurants with vegan options near me.”

Moreover, optimizing meta descriptions and headlines for voice search is crucial, as these elements are often read aloud by smart speakers. By adapting to this change, publishers can attract more organic traffic and improve their overall digital presence.
